Cochin University College of Engineering Kuttanad
Cochin University College of Engineering Kuttanad (CUCEK) is an engineering college in India. It was founded in October 1999, under the aegis of Cochin University of Science and Technology (CUSAT) , at Pulincunnu in Kuttanad in the state of Kerala in India. Students are admitted based upon their rank in Cusat CAT Entrance Exam.
This College is situated in the outskirts of Pulnicunnu Panchayat, in the periphery of a sleepy village called "Kannady", meaning ‘mirror’. The College attracts a large number of students from the Hindi speaking belt, particularly from UP, Bihar and Orissa for its quality of education and the serene and pollution free atmosphere in which it is imparted. It Comprises Cochin University College of Engineering, Kuttanad (CUCEK) offering various B.Tech. Engineering programmes and Cochin University College of Computer Applications, Kuttanad(CUCCAK) offering M.C.A. programme.
The courses offered are B.Tech. in Mechanical Engineering ,Electrical and Electronics Engineering ,Electronics & Comm. Engineering ,Computer Science & Engineering and Information Technology.
